WebApr 5, 2024 · Delhi University has decided to grant a five year extension to professors and senior professors after their retirement. As per DU officials, this decision has been made in order to promote the research culture in India and to re-employ research academicians.

Transparency, openness, and reproducibility are readily recognized as vital features of science ( 1, 2 ). When asked, most scientists embrace these features as disciplinary norms and values ( 3 ). Therefore, one might expect that these valued features would be routine in daily practice.
